Peachtree Will Not Reinstall
"Sage Peachtree" is accounting software that gives an organization standard accounting and business management tools. If you have uninstalled the program and can not reinstall it, this can be due to a number of issues on the computer or network. Troubleshooting the installation may vary depending on whether you are running the program on one computer or if you run the program from a server that shares it with workstations on a network.
Instructions
-
-
1
Uninstall the previous version of the software completely. If you have remaining files from the old installation, this may conflict with the new files.
-
2
Disable the antivirus and firewall programs on the computer. If you run Peachtree from a server, you may need to disable these programs on the server as well.
-
-
3
Click the "Start" button to launch the Start menu.
-
4
Type "msconfig" in the textbox and press the "Enter" key on the keyboard.
-
5
Navigate to the "Startup" tab. This will show you a list of programs that start when the computer boots. It is possible that certain programs could cause a conflict that prevent you from installing Peachtree on the computer.
-
6
Remove the check from the box next to all programs you do not need to launch on computer startup.
-
7
Navigate to the "Services" tab. This will show you all services that start when the computer boots up.
-
8
Place a mark in the box next to "Hide all Microsoft Services."
-
9
Remove the check from the box next to all services you do not need to launch on computer startup.
-
10
Click the "OK" button and allow the computer to reboot.
-
11
Log in to the computer using the administrator account and attempt to reinstall Peachtree again. With the firewall, virus scanner and all unneeded programs shut down, you should be able to install the program without any software conflicts.
